Approximately 22 million Americans suffer from sleep apnea and nearly 80 million are overweight. Both of these problems are at epidemic levels, and they have made a costly impact on the overall health of Americans. Sleep apnea and obesity are implicated as causes of heart disease, cancer, diabetes, and hypertension. However, there is also a strong relationship between these two conditions as well, and millions are afflicted with both. Your liver is a very important part of your body; it filters harmful chemicals out of your blood, metabolizes drugs, and produces proteins that help your body perform important functions. However, like any organ in your body, the liver can be damaged by chronic misuse or by certain diseases. What is Cirrhosis? Damage to the liver can take the form of scarring.
